From Stanmer House (c.1724) we walk up through some magnificent cypress trees into Great Wood, gradually climbing all the way up to the fabulous viewing point of Ditchling Beacon, one of the highest points on the South Downs. The walk begins in the village of Ditchling just to the north of Ditchling Beacon and follows the Sussex Border Path to Burnhouse Bostall. Then it's up to the downs for a walk through typical downland, undulating fields and copses and on to the top for fine views of the Weald from the South Downs Way and Ditchling Beacon, through National Trust land and back through some interesting old mixed deciduous woodland. Service 78 to Stanmer Park: £2.70 single and £5 return; Service 79 to Ditchling Beacon: £3 single, £5 return; Return tickets can be used to return from Devil's Dyke, Stanmer Park or Ditchling Beacon: so they are ideal for walkers too!
